Man linked through DNA to 2012 sexual assault is convicted

Justin Simon of Kansas City was found guilty of rape, sodomy and second-degree robbery in the June 2012 attack.

A Jackson County jury on Thursday convicted a 31-year-old man whose DNA linked him to a 2012 rape of a woman near 33rd Street and Southwest Trafficway.

The defendant, Justin Simon of Kansas City, was found guilty of rape, sodomy and second-degree robbery in the June 2012 attack, according to prosecutors.

Authorities said Simon and another man offered to give a woman a ride home after she left a bar. The men walked the woman to an apartment building, where their vehicle was parked. There, Simon punched the woman and took her into an apartment, where both men sexually assaulted her.

Simon is scheduled to be sentenced Feb. 9.
